A mobile video-sharing app spun out of Justin.tv. Rode the Facebook Open Graph wave to millions of downloads by auto-posting every video view to users' Facebook feeds without clear consent, making it look viral when it was really just spam . Autodesk — a company that makes architecture software — inexplicably acquired it for $60M in 2012. Then shut it down in 2015. A $60M detour for a CAD company that wanted to be cool. Michael Seibel went on to run YC. The circle of life.
